Station Amenities and Accessibility

Despite its modest size, Kings Sutton station offers several crucial amenities for travelers. While it doesn’t feature a full-fledged ticket office, there are ticket machines available to purchase tickets, making it easy to collect tickets that were bought online. This station supports accessibility with induction loops for those with hearing impairments and has step-free access to platform 2. This ensures ease for those traveling towards Oxford and London Marylebone.

Although there is no staff assistance available on site, help points and a customer helpline are in place to address travelers' concerns. Unfortunately, waiting rooms, seating areas, and accessible toilets are missing, which means a bit of waiting might need to be done outside but with a cautious eye on the beautiful surroundings. Travelers requiring assistance can make arrangements for taxis to nearby Banbury station if needed. In this context, the station adopts a supportive approach by facilitating communications via Passenger Assist as well.

Facilities and Amenities

Southend East station is equipped with an array of facilities to cater to your travel needs. Whether you're purchasing your ticket or collecting one bought online, services are available with convenient opening hours. From Monday to Friday, the ticket office opens from 05:15 to 18:00, while weekend hours vary slightly. You can find accessible ticket machines and a helpful induction loop, ensuring a smooth experience for everyone.

For those seeking assistance, helpful station staff are available Monday through Friday from 06:00 to 19:30. You can find customer help points and detailed screens with departure information along with regular announcements to keep you up to date. The installation of CCTV across the station ensures a safe environment for all passengers.

Accessibility Considerations

Accessibility options are robust, particularly with step-free access available to London-bound platform 1. However, some areas may have limitations. There are accessible ticket machines and toilets on-site, along with ramp access for those boarding trains. Although there's no wheelchair availability or accessible taxis at the station, these facilities are compensated for by attentive staff willing to offer support.

Amenities for Comfort and Convenience

For comfort while waiting, you have access to cozy waiting rooms located on platform 1, open until late evening during weekdays. Refreshments are available, although food and drink options might be limited, with no shops or ATMs present. Thanks to public Wi-Fi, passengers can stay connected while they wait.
